Addressing Traffic Violations with Driving Ticket Classes

Receiving a traffic ticket in Florida can be a stressful experience, but it doesn’t have to leave a permanent mark on your record. Many drivers opt for a driving ticket classes, formally known as a Basic Driver Improvement (BDI) course, to offset the negative effects of a traffic citation. These classes are often court-approved and designed to help drivers avoid points on their licenses, reduce fines, and maintain lower insurance premiums.

Enrolling in a driving ticket class is straightforward. These programs cover essential topics such as traffic laws, defensive driving techniques, and strategies for avoiding future violations. By completing such a course, drivers demonstrate their commitment to safe driving, which can positively influence their driving record and overall confidence on the road.

Types of Courses Offered

Drive Florida Safe Driving School provides various courses to address diverse needs. Here’s an overview:

Basic Driver Improvement (BDI)

The BDI course is designed for drivers who have received a traffic ticket or want to avoid points on their license. By completing this course, drivers can prevent insurance rate increases and enhance their knowledge of traffic laws and safe driving practices.

Traffic Collision Avoidance Course (TCAC)

This course is ideal for drivers involved in a collision or those who want to improve their defensive driving skills. The program focuses on techniques to prevent accidents, identify hazards, and react appropriately to challenging road conditions.

Advanced Driver Improvement (ADI)

The ADI course is mandatory for drivers with a suspended or revoked license. It provides an in-depth understanding of safe driving principles, helping participants reinstate their license and reduce the likelihood of future violations.

First-Time Driver (TLSAE)

The Traffic Law and Substance Abuse Education (TLSAE) course is a requirement for new drivers in Florida. It covers essential topics such as traffic laws, the effects of alcohol and drugs on driving, and safe driving techniques.

Senior Driver Courses

Tailored for older drivers, these courses focus on maintaining driving skills, adapting to physical changes, and understanding modern traffic laws and technologies.

The Importance of Work Zone Safety

Florida’s roads are constantly evolving with improvements, making work zones a common sight. While these areas signify progress and development, they also present unique challenges and hazards for drivers. Each year, numerous crashes occur in work zones, resulting in preventable injuries and fatalities. As responsible drivers, we must ensure that we contribute to the solution rather than becoming part of the problem.

Staying Alert and Vigilant

Work zones can emerge unexpectedly, with layouts that change daily. It is essential to remain vigilant and keep your eyes on the road. Look out for signs and be prepared for sudden shifts in traffic patterns. Distractions, even momentary, can have severe consequences in these areas. Staying alert is the first step towards ensuring safety in work zones. Learn the same approach from Florida driving classes and keep practicing.

The Necessity of Slowing Down

Speed limits in work zones are not arbitrary; they are there to protect both drivers and road workers. Even if workers are not visibly present, it is crucial to adhere to the posted speed limits. Reducing your speed allows for better reaction times to unexpected changes and obstacles, thereby reducing the likelihood of accidents.

Maintaining a Safe Distance

Tailgating is dangerous under any circumstances, but it is particularly hazardous in work zones where sudden stops are common. Maintaining a safe distance from the vehicle ahead gives you ample time to react to abrupt changes in traffic flow. This simple practice can prevent rear-end collisions, which are frequent in work zones.

Planning for Delays

Work zones often cause delays and slow down traffic. Planning your trips with extra time in mind can help you avoid the stress and risky behaviors associated with rushing. Accepting the possibility of delays allows you to remain calm and focused, which is essential for safe driving in these challenging areas. Following Instructions and Signals

Signs, signals, and flaggers are present in work zones to guide traffic safely through the area. Paying close attention to these instructions and following them precisely ensures that traffic moves smoothly and safely. Flaggers, in particular, play a critical role in managing traffic flow, and their directions should always be respected.

Exercising Patience

Patience is a virtue, especially in work zones where everyone is navigating the same obstacles. Frustration can lead to reckless driving behaviors, increasing the risk of collisions. By remaining patient and courteous, you contribute to a safer environment for all road users.
